Jamaican vs Nigerian Per Capita Income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 368,110,686 people shows a moderate negative correlation between the proportion of Jamaicans and per capita income in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of -0.457 and weighted average of $39,231.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 332,796,588 people shows a weak negative correlation between the proportion of Nigerians and per capita income in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of -0.245 and weighted average of $41,026, a difference of 4.6%.
